Gliadin IgA Antibodies

This antibody is found in ~80% of patients with coeliac disease. It is directed against the alpha/beta and gamma (α,β,γ) gliadins. It is also found in a number of patients who are not enteropathic. Some of these patients may have neuropathies that respond favorably to a gluten elimination diet. This is referred to as gluten-sensitive idiopathic neuropathy.

 

Specimen: 0.2 ml Serum

Reference Values: 

Negative: <12 U/ml
Equivocal: 12-18 U/ml
Positive: >18 U/ml

Method: CLIA   

Loinc: 6924-5
